With regards to Plymouths plight, surely they have to have things relatively sorted by tomorrow or on the pitch they will be basically screwed.
I say this as it's the closing of the transfer window. Without having their house in order, if they haven't sealed any permanent signings by tomorrow they won't be able to bring in any permanent signings until jan 1st (annoyingly the day before we face them at home park).
So if they don't sign anyone tomorrow they are stuck with the current squad, bar free transfers and loans. Any free agents now, you have to wonder why they haven't been snapped up yet. And loan players, well they already have Hitchcock, Gibson and Atkinson on long term loan so only have room for 2 more loanees in their matchday squad.
So basically, they'll be stuck with what they've got until January unless they do some serious wheeling and dealing tomorrow.
